About Rong Liu

Rong Liu is a scholar working on Mechanics of Materials, Mechanical Engineering and Civil and Structural Engineering, having authored 166 papers that have together received 2.7k indexed citations. Recurring topics across this work include Cellular and Composite Structures (33 papers), Advanced materials and composites (21 papers) and Composite Structure Analysis and Optimization (20 papers). The work is most often cited by research in Mechanical Engineering (1.6k citations), Mechanics of Materials (974 citations) and Metals and Alloys (86 citations). Rong Liu has collaborated with scholars based in China, Canada and Singapore. Frequent co-authors include D.Y Li, Jianhua Yao, Qunli Zhang, Zhong Yifeng, Matthew Yao, Xijia Wu, Liang Wang, Song Ren, Xiang Jiang and Guhui Gao. Their work appears in journals such as SHILAP Revista de lepidopterología, Chemistry of Materials and Chemical Engineering Journal.
